What Drives Private Banking Mortgage Advisor Compensation?
The median (P50) compensation for a Private Banking Mortgage Advisor is $115,000, with the 25th to 75th percentile range spanning $90,000 to $145,000. The 48% spread between P25 and P75 reflects significant pay variation driven by book size and client AUM, revenue generated, client segment (HNW vs. UHNW), product complexity, regulatory licensing, and the firm's compensation model (salary + bonus vs. revenue share). Demand is holding stable, with compensation levels expected to track broader market adjustments.
Private Banking Mortgage Advisor Career Path
Professionals who move into Private Banking Mortgage Advisor roles most commonly come from institutional banking, financial advisory, trust and estate law, investment management, or family office operations. From this position, the typical trajectory leads toward managing director and market head positions, regional leadership, or transitioning to independent RIA or multi-family office platforms. The average tenure in this role is approximately 3.5 years, with an annual turnover rate of 18%.
